Lee, did me the first 47 tooth version just in time for my euro trip (thanks lee), I fitted it as it came (med/soft springs) and it worked a treat, very light to squeeze…no dicking about etc etc….it did exactly what it was supposed to do, I swapped the springs to some MB ones I had as wasn’t used to it being so light (I probably didn’t need to, but it’s what I’m used to), any way it worked a treat (400 odd miles) with no problems, it can pull really well with no slippage all the way through the gears.

right boys and girls , finally got somewhere with my own redesign ,no longer using aprillia baskets and plates due to machining time and availability , im now using a yamaha derived plate and my own cast basket that im now happy with , ive currently machined ten 5 plate 46 tooth clutches and am about to start on the 47 tooth version , cost is £200, £180 if you supply the correct exchange crownwheel ....
